Louise Horkan

Assistant Headteacher -Year 1-4 Student Culture and Experience

With currently 10 years’ experience working in a Primary School setting, I joined GEMS Wellington International School in 2017 when I made my first move to Dubai, after teaching in an Outstanding school in the UK. I have a BA (Hons) degree in Economics and Geography from the National University of Ireland, Galway and then proceeded to complete a PGCE in Canterbury University.

In my previous role as Head of Year 2, I supported the social, personal and development of my team and students. I am thrilled to be moving into the Senior Leadership Team as Assistant Headteacher of Student Culture and Experience. My journey in my educational career has led me to become an ambitious and highly skilled leader who looks to develop the opportunities that are offered to students, staff, and parents at WIS. I look to embed a range of pastoral programs, whilst leading student culture in an effective and impactful manner. I await the opportunity to working alongside parents and stakeholders in planning many high-quality parental engagement events for everyone in the WIS community.
